The 2000s is when educational technology started to get smart and it became portable. We were introduced to multiple ways to connect with each other and instructors had more options for using technology to supplement instruction. I’ve listed a few things that were introduced in the 2000s.
SMART AND PORTABLE
2001 Apple iPod
2002 Proliferation of laptops
2005 USB Drives replace CDs
2007 Apple iPhone
2007 Amazon Kindle
2008 Macbook Air
CONNECTIVITY
2001 Wikipedia
2003 Skype
2005 Box
2004 Facebook
2006 Google Docs
2005 YouTube
TECH SUPPLEMENTS INSTRUCTION
2000 Achieve3000
2006 Khan Academy
2006 Haiku LMS
2007 Innosight Institute
2008 Document Camera
2008 Edmodo
